“The Poetry of Protest” our show in the Gallery of Art and Design at the University of Central Missouri of large prints of photographs from rallies, protests, marches, and demonstrations opened on September 26th. The exhibit closed on October 28th.

The exhibit is closed.

We left an open notebook with blank pages and pencils on a podium next to the exhibit title wall. The last comments:

Awesome: Thanks for all the clear evidences of democracy. It was truly enjoyable.

So important that children in the future know that were those of us who stood up against the war on democracy, truth, kindness [and] the environment – oh, yeah [and] the nuclear war being waged against women. Thank you for preserving this so the protests are not lost.
